Alcohol And Stroke Risk: Uncovering The Hidden Connection To Brain Health

does alcohol increase stroke risk

Alcohol consumption has long been a subject of debate in relation to its impact on health, particularly concerning stroke risk. While moderate drinking is often associated with potential cardiovascular benefits, such as increased HDL (good) cholesterol, excessive or long-term alcohol use can have detrimental effects. Studies suggest that heavy drinking may elevate blood pressure, contribute to atrial fibrillation, and lead to conditions like cardiomyopathy, all of which are significant risk factors for stroke. Additionally, alcohol can interfere with blood clotting mechanisms and increase inflammation, further exacerbating stroke risk. Understanding the nuanced relationship between alcohol intake and stroke is crucial for individuals and healthcare providers to make informed decisions about lifestyle choices and preventive measures.

Moderate vs. Heavy Drinking

Alcohol's impact on stroke risk isn't a simple yes-or-no question. The relationship is nuanced, with the amount consumed playing a pivotal role. Understanding the difference between moderate and heavy drinking is crucial for anyone concerned about their health.

Defining the Lines: What Constitutes Moderate vs. Heavy?

Moderate drinking is generally defined as up to one drink per day for women and up to two drinks per day for men. A "drink" is standardized: 12 ounces of beer (5% ABV), 5 ounces of wine (12% ABV), or 1.5 ounces of distilled spirits (40% ABV). Heavy drinking, on the other hand, is anything exceeding these limits. For women, it's more than seven drinks per week or three drinks on any single day. For men, it's more than 14 drinks per week or four drinks on any single day.

Binge drinking, a dangerous subset of heavy drinking, is defined as consuming four or more drinks for women and five or more drinks for men within a short timeframe, typically around two hours.

The J-Shaped Curve: A Complex Relationship

Research suggests a J-shaped curve when it comes to alcohol and stroke risk. This means that compared to abstainers, moderate drinkers may have a slightly lower risk of certain types of stroke, particularly ischemic stroke (caused by a blood clot). However, this potential benefit disappears and risk skyrockets with heavy drinking. Studies show that heavy drinkers have a significantly increased risk of all types of stroke, including hemorrhagic stroke (caused by bleeding in the brain).

The reason for this J-shaped curve isn't fully understood, but it may involve alcohol's complex effects on blood clotting, blood pressure, and inflammation.

Alcohol’s Impact on Blood Pressure

Alcohol's effect on blood pressure is a critical factor in understanding its role in stroke risk. Even moderate drinking can lead to a temporary increase in blood pressure, while chronic, heavy consumption is linked to long-term hypertension. Studies show that consuming more than 3 drinks in one sitting can cause a significant spike in blood pressure, with the effect lasting up to 24 hours. For context, one standard drink is defined as 14 grams of pure alcohol, equivalent to a 12-ounce beer, 5-ounce glass of wine, or 1.5-ounce shot of distilled spirits.

Consider the mechanism: alcohol interferes with the nervous system’s ability to regulate blood pressure, causing blood vessels to constrict and the heart to pump faster. Over time, this strain can damage artery walls, leading to atherosclerosis, a major contributor to stroke. Research indicates that individuals who consume more than 2 drinks per day are at a 1.5 times higher risk of developing hypertension compared to non-drinkers. Age plays a role too; individuals over 50 are more susceptible to alcohol-induced blood pressure changes due to reduced vascular elasticity.

Practical steps to mitigate risk include limiting daily intake to 1 drink for women and 2 for men, as recommended by health guidelines. Monitoring blood pressure regularly, especially after drinking, can provide insight into individual sensitivity. For those with pre-existing hypertension, reducing alcohol consumption or abstaining entirely may be necessary. Pairing alcohol with water and avoiding binge drinking can also help minimize spikes.

Comparatively, while moderate drinking (1 drink/day for women, 2 for men) may have a slight protective effect on the heart for some, this benefit is outweighed by the blood pressure risks for heavy drinkers. For instance, a 2019 study in *Hypertension* found that reducing alcohol intake lowered systolic blood pressure by an average of 4.5 mmHg in heavy drinkers. This highlights the importance of moderation and individualized risk assessment.

Atrial Fibrillation and Alcohol

Alcohol's impact on atrial fibrillation (AFib) is a critical yet often overlooked aspect of stroke risk. AFib, characterized by irregular heart rhythms, significantly increases the likelihood of blood clots and subsequent strokes. Even moderate alcohol consumption can trigger AFib episodes, particularly in individuals already predisposed to the condition. Studies show that as little as one to two drinks per day can elevate the risk of AFib by up to 8%, with heavier drinking amplifying this danger exponentially. For those with a history of AFib, understanding this relationship is essential for stroke prevention.

Consider the mechanism: alcohol disrupts the electrical signals in the heart, leading to erratic contractions. This effect is dose-dependent, meaning the more alcohol consumed, the greater the disruption. For instance, binge drinking—defined as five or more drinks in a single session for men, or four for women—can provoke immediate AFib episodes, even in otherwise healthy individuals. Chronic drinkers face an even higher risk, as long-term alcohol use can remodel heart tissue, making AFib more likely to recur. This highlights the importance of moderation, especially for those with cardiovascular vulnerabilities.

Practical steps can mitigate alcohol-induced AFib risk. First, limit daily intake to one drink for women and two for men, aligning with general health guidelines. Second, avoid binge drinking entirely, as its acute effects on heart rhythm are particularly hazardous. Third, monitor for AFib symptoms—such as palpitations, dizziness, or shortness of breath—after consuming alcohol, and consult a healthcare provider if these occur. For individuals with diagnosed AFib, abstaining from alcohol may be the safest option, as even small amounts can provoke episodes.

Blood Clotting and Alcohol Consumption

Alcohol's impact on blood clotting is a critical factor in understanding its role in stroke risk. At moderate levels—typically defined as up to one drink per day for women and up to two for men—alcohol can exhibit anticoagulant properties, thinning the blood and potentially reducing clot formation. This effect is often attributed to alcohol’s ability to increase platelet inhibition and elevate levels of fibrinolytic activity, which helps dissolve clots. However, this seemingly protective mechanism is dose-dependent and quickly reverses at higher consumption levels.

Excessive alcohol intake, particularly binge drinking (defined as four or more drinks for women and five or more for men in a single session), disrupts this balance. Heavy drinking can lead to dehydration and increased platelet aggregation, both of which promote clot formation. Chronic heavy drinking also damages blood vessels, fostering inflammation and endothelial dysfunction, conditions that further elevate clotting risks. For individuals over 65, even moderate drinking may pose risks due to age-related vascular changes, making clotting complications more likely.

A comparative analysis reveals a paradox: while moderate drinking may mimic the effects of low-dose aspirin in reducing clotting, heavy consumption mimics the dangers of untreated hypertension or hypercoagulable states. For instance, a 50-year-old man consuming three drinks daily is at a significantly higher risk of developing atrial fibrillation—a condition linked to stroke via blood clot formation—compared to his moderate-drinking peers. This highlights the importance of dosage and frequency in alcohol’s clotting effects.

Practical tips for mitigating clotting risks include staying hydrated, as alcohol’s diuretic effects can thicken blood and promote clotting. Limiting daily intake to one drink for women and two for men, and avoiding binge drinking, are evidence-based strategies. Individuals with pre-existing clotting disorders or those on anticoagulant medications should consult healthcare providers, as alcohol can interfere with medication efficacy. Monitoring blood pressure and cholesterol levels is also crucial, as alcohol-induced vascular damage compounds clotting risks.

Gender Differences in Stroke Risk

Alcohol's impact on stroke risk isn't one-size-fits-all. Research reveals a fascinating gender disparity, highlighting the need for tailored prevention strategies. Men, historically consuming more alcohol than women, face a higher overall stroke risk. This correlation is particularly strong for hemorrhagic strokes, where excessive drinking weakens blood vessels, making them prone to rupture. Studies suggest that men who consume more than two drinks per day significantly elevate their risk compared to moderate drinkers.

"But what about women?" you might ask. The relationship between alcohol and stroke risk in women is more nuanced. While heavy drinking still poses a threat, moderate consumption (defined as one drink or less per day) has been linked to a slightly lower risk of ischemic stroke, the most common type. This protective effect is thought to be related to alcohol's ability to increase HDL (good) cholesterol and potentially improve blood vessel function. However, this benefit is modest and doesn't outweigh the numerous other health risks associated with alcohol consumption.

It's crucial to remember that these are general trends, and individual risk factors like family history, blood pressure, and smoking play a significant role. Women shouldn't interpret this as a green light to drink more. The potential benefits are small and outweighed by the risks of breast cancer, liver disease, and other alcohol-related problems.

Instead of focusing on alcohol as a preventative measure, both men and women should prioritize proven stroke-prevention strategies: maintaining a healthy weight, exercising regularly, controlling blood pressure and cholesterol, and quitting smoking.

For those who choose to drink, moderation is key. The American Heart Association recommends no more than one drink per day for women and two drinks per day for men. Remember, a "drink" is defined as 12 ounces of beer, 5 ounces of wine, or 1.5 ounces of distilled spirits. Exceeding these limits significantly increases stroke risk, regardless of gender.
